Default 4L60E Guru needed!

When i do a WOT 1-2 shift i hear a squeel or squeek coming from the trans. It's a short and sharp squeek that happens as it slams into second gear. Only happens during WOT or almost WOT.
I was told this was the bands and not indicating any problem or causing harm to the trans.
Anyone else hear anything like this?

I have seen this happen in the past (many years ago), and it seems that it was the fluid that caused this if my memory serves me right. There have been different types of band/clutch material that can cause this also, but I would not necessarily worry about it, just change to a different fluid. If you know what fluid you are running now, that might be of help?
